Small Groups

Come and Join one of our Small Groups!


Participating in small groups gives us a chance to develop relationships with other people as we learn more about the Christian faith and how we live our faith on a day-by-day basis. These groups are a safe place to ask questions, share our thoughts, and simply be who we are joined with others who are on this journey of faith. “The Earth is the Lord’s”
Lent Reflection Group

Beginning Wednesday, March 12 at 7 p.m. and continuing through the season of Lent, there will be an opportunity to gather and reflect on topics related to environmentalism, creation care, and eco-theology. Worship services during Lent will highlight these issues in a series called, “The Earth is the Lord’s,” and each Wednesday evening Pastor Andy will lead a reflection on ideas and questions that emerge from the previous Sunday’s worship time. No book purchase is required; each week will be a stand-alone set of reflection questions.
